Responsibilities
- Design, implement, and maintain distributed software systems with a focus on AI-enabled product capabilities, Voice AI agents, and LLM-powered workflows.
- Drive technical architecture.
- Define system architecture, business domain boundaries, scalability strategies, infrastructure requirements, monitoring, and technical documentation.
- Collaborate with Product Management, Design, architects, and engineering teams to define requirements, evaluate solutions, and deliver high-quality products.
- Lead engineering execution.
- Guide sprint planning, support software deployment, contribute code, perform pull request reviews, maintain security and quality standards, and support products throughout their lifecycle.
- Mentor engineers, support hiring, lead Beta cycles, troubleshoot production issues, manage escalations, and help drive Agile development practices.
- Evaluate frameworks, technologies, and build-versus-buy decisions while leveraging AI-assisted development tools to accelerate delivery.
